(a) Contents. The state agency shall prepare a chronological report detailing the specific steps used by the state agency during its selection process. This report shall include:
- (1) the criteria used in the screening process;
- (2) the interviews and the ratings of all firms considered;
- (3) a copy of the approved minutes of any board action affecting the selection process, if applicable; and
- (4) If an out-of-state firm is selected, the report must include the justification for the selection.
- (b) Delivery to Department. The report must be submitted to the Department for an independent review of the complete selection process.
